+void xnn_f32_vneg_ukernel__avx512f_x16(
+ size_t n,
+ const float* x,
+ float* y,
+ const union xnn_f32_neg_params params[restrict XNN_MIN_ELEMENTS(1)])
+{
+ assert(n != 0);
+ assert(n % sizeof(float) == 0);
+
+ const __m512i vsign_mask = _mm512_broadcast_i32x4(_mm_load_si128((const __m128i*) params->sse.sign_mask));
+ for (; n >= 16 * sizeof(float); n -= 16 * sizeof(float)) {
+ const __m512i vx0123456789ABCDEF = _mm512_loadu_epi32(x);
+ x += 16;
+
+ const __m512i vy0123456789ABCDEF = _mm512_xor_epi32(vx0123456789ABCDEF, vsign_mask);
+
+ _mm512_storeu_epi32(y, vy0123456789ABCDEF);
+ y += 16;
+ }
+ if XNN_UNLIKELY(n != 0) {
+ assert(n >= 1 * sizeof(float));
+ assert(n <= 15 * sizeof(float));
+ // Prepare mask for valid 32-bit elements (depends on n).
+ n >>= 2 /* log2(sizeof(float)) */;
+ const __mmask16 vmask = _cvtu32_mask16((uint16_t) ((uint32_t) (UINT32_C(1) << n) - UINT32_C(1)));
+
+ const __m512i vx = _mm512_maskz_loadu_epi32(vmask, x);
+ const __m512i vy = _mm512_xor_epi32(vx, vsign_mask);
+ _mm512_mask_storeu_epi32(y, vmask, vy);
+ }
+}
